Skier dies after apparently hitting a tree at Solitude Mountain Resort​on February 23, 2025 at 12:48 am

Big Cottonwood Canyon, Utah • A man died Saturday after he appeared to have crashed into a tree while skiing at Solitude Mountain Resort.

A 53-year-old skier from Connecticut died after apparently hitting a tree at Solitude on Saturday.

Unified Police said the skier was found unresponsive around 1:15 p.m. toward the bottom of Middle Slope. Members of ski patrol attempted lifesaving measures before the man died.

The victim was identified as 53-year-old Daniel Negrelli of Canton, Connecticut.
